Types of Rock Crushers | Quarry Crushing Equipment | Kemper

Impact Crushers – VSIs and HSIs. Impact-style crushers include VSIs, as well as horizontal shaft impactors (HSIs), and are best used with less abrasive rock types, like limestone. These types of machines break apart material by the impacting forces of certain wear parts known as blow bars and impact plates or toggles.. What Are Crushers? | Omnia Machinery

Jaw crushers are the archetypal crusher used for the dismantling of rock and stone; with a quarry jaw crusher, you are able to crush all kinds of materials to various sizes depending on your requirements. Explanatory by name, jaw crushers reduce materials between a fixed and a moving jaw. The moving jaw puts pressure on the material and pushes it against the stationary plate, the rocks …

Crush and Run Instead of Gravel Under Slab ...

Filling y0ur whole foundation with clear-crsushed is a waste. No one i know here does it. Crusher run compacts easily with a bit if diligence, and is much easier on your buried plumbing. The reason to use rock is to provide a capillary break, so it's a good idea to top dress the 6" below the slab with a drainable fill.

Crushers - an overview | ScienceDirect Topics

Oleg D. Neikov, in Handbook of Non-Ferrous Metal Powders, 2009 Crushers. Crushers are widely used as a primary stage to produce the particulate product finer than about 50–100 mm in size. They are classified as jaw, gyratory and cone crushers based on compression, cutter mill based on shear and hammer crusher based on impact.

Best mobile crusher for recycling concrete | Page 2 ...

I have direct experience crushing hard rock and concrete too. Concrete, brick, and block go through the crusher fast. You should get lots of TPH if your feed is clean. The downside is that these materials can have more of a "sandpaper" effect than many hard rock materials.
